
The English to Speakers of Other Languages (ESOL) program is a state funded language assistance instructional program that serves eligible English Learners (ELs) in grades K-12. The objective of the program is to support the development of English language proficiency in the areas of listening, speaking, reading and writing.
The program's curriculum emphasizes social/instructional and academic language proficiency. It is based on the integration of the WIDA English Language Development (ELD) Standards and the Georgia Standards of Excellence/Georgia Performance Standards.
